This podcast episode discusses the growing prevalence of digital subscriptions and how they often lead consumers into exploitable situations with rising costs and privacy concerns. James highlights the challenges posed by bundled services and the difficulty in managing and canceling such commitments. He urges listeners to be cautious and well-informed about where their data goes and the terms of their subscriptions. By sharing strategies for better management of digital services, the episode encourages a more mindful approach to digital consumption, emphasizing the importance of privacy and the flexibility to switch providers without undue hardship.
